Role Overview

We are seeking a Works Inspector specialized in Roading who thrives while working outdoors on the network, collaborating with others, and delivering high-quality outcomes that support the community. This role emphasizes both technical competence and a positive, team-oriented outlook committed to integrity and excellence.

Key Responsibilities

As a Works Inspector in Roading, you will ensure the safety, reliability, and maintenance of our roading network. Your duties involve close coordination with contractors, consultants, internal teams, and the community to manage maintenance and capital projects, oversee asset condition, and contribute to the delivery of superior infrastructure services.

Additional qualifications and experience include:

  • Possession of a Full New Zealand Driver Licence.
  • Holding a National Diploma Level 5, National Certificate Level 6, or equivalent in a relevant field.
  • Approximately 3-4 years' background in contract administration, works supervision, civil infrastructure delivery, or a related area.
  • Familiarity with roading assets, civil engineering practices, local government asset management systems, and pertinent legislation.
